The Microsoft Network is a compilation of internet based services offered by technology titan Microsoft. Microsoft was founded by Bill Gates and his childhood friend Paul Allen. Both Gates and Allen enjoyed computer programming and were trying to find a way to use their skills to build a successful business. By the 1980s, their creation, Microsoft, began producing operating systems. Today, anyone that owns a personal computer or works with computers has heard of Microsoft and at least one of its founders.

Anyone can play MSN Games without an account. The games are usually preceded by an advertisement. Users that wish to challenge friends or follow others will have to create an MSN account. Users can sign in using a Windows Live or Facebook profile by clicking the corresponding buttons at the top right hand corner of the MSN Games homepage. If the user does not have one of these accounts, they can create a Windows Live account by clicking the icon then clicking the grey “Sign Up” button along the right hand side of the page. A Windows Live membership allows the user to access Hotmail, Messenger, and Xbox Live. The registration form asks for a password, email address, country/region, secret question and answer, first and last name, gender, date of birth, and other location details.
